Maria's time in Ghana
My projects for the foreign assignment
Now I would like to tell you about my great time in Ghana. I was there for 8 weeks as a volunteer in a street children project in Accra.
My goals for this stay abroad in Ghana were to get to know a new culture, to improve my English language skills and to appreciate my own homeland. I am happy to say that I have achieved all three goals.

My experience in street children project
The work in the street children project in Accra was a lot of fun and joy for me. I looked after the 0-6 year old children there, swaddled them, washed them, fed them and taught them little things. They have partially learned to walk and speak. Every kind of development I experienced in this project made me super happy. After a while you notice how the children trust you and that can no longer be taken from you. Every child's laughter makes one forget the actual poverty in which the children live.

Leisure activities in Ghana
We traveled a lot at the weekend. There are many wonderful places to visit. In addition to the Castel and Kakum National Parc in Cape Coast, the great beach in Busua, the Wli Waterfalls in the Volta Region & a chillout place in Ada-Foah, it is definitely worth a trip to the north of Ghana. There you can see elephants, buffalo, monkeys and antelopes in the Mole National Park.
